-
1 # TonyDeng
-
2 # 高科技讓人煩惱
模擬器已經有了,不過不是微軟做的,微軟的模擬器做這個的可能性不大。不同的作業系統不存在相容這種說法,與底層結合緊密的程式也不可能出現相容的情況,基於解析器的程式一直都相容的。
-
3 # huzibbs
你說的感覺有點懸,首先微軟win10已經有linux子系統核心,主要針對的是開發者,普通使用者很少用得到,而蘋果的mac os已經有自己的硬體,主要賣點就是自己的系統配合自己的硬體,假如蘋果開放mac os許可權那麼就不只是黑蘋果系統氾濫的問題了,可能會威脅到蘋果的利益。我相信蘋果不會這麼做的[捂臉]
-
4 # 物聯縱深
現在看,不太現實,二者底層程式碼不同,兩個生態的商業模式也不同,而且蘋果已經自成閉環,又形成了業界標杆,也不會願意花大工夫去做這件自廢武功的事兒。
-
5 # JackdailyLife
首先,感謝邀請回答這個問題;
相信提問者已經非常清楚 windows 和 Mac OS 區別,這是兩個不同的公司 開發的商業電腦作業系統,Windows 和Mac OS都有它獨有的核心;
Mac OS 是 Apple公司基於 Darwin-XNU核心開發的 電腦桌面作業系統;之所以叫XNU ,類Unix,是
因為Unix的商標權由國際開放標準組織所擁有,並且規定只有符合單一UNIX規範的UNIX系統才能使用UNIX這個名稱,否則只能稱為類UNIX。
再補充點Linux,我們平時說的 Linux,其實是 基於Linux 核心 開發的 各種 發行版,比如 Ubuntu、Debian、CentOS、RedHat等
那麼 回到正題:微軟是否能讓 Windows 相容 Mac OS 呢?我的答案是:技術上能做到相容,但是微軟不能這樣去做。技術可能性分析:蘋果的作業系統 基於 其自己研發的XNU核心,2017年之前,我會回答你,技術上也沒有辦法相容,因為它是閉源的,我們看不到它的原始碼,記得2017年時候,蘋果國慶期間在GitHub上公佈了XNU核心原始碼,XNU 核心被用在 Mac OS 以及 iOS等 蘋果各類 Darwin作業系統上。現在 能看到 核心原始碼,那麼Windows 相容它成為了可能;
商業意義分析:Windows 之所以 相容 Linux,首先是它完全開源,完全不會有 商業 衝突,再者,雖然Linux 不是Unix,但是它屬於後起之秀,幾乎和Unix 進行媲美。對各類商業 有著很好的適應性,能承載小到微控制器、大到大型企業伺服器的 任務;而且 對各領域開發者 非常友好,各種開發工具非常齊全。為了增加 Windows 作業系統的 實用性,所以微軟 在Windows 中 增加了一個 Linux 的子系統;
反觀 如果 增加 XNU子系統,就有些多餘了,因為 XNU 能帶給Windows的實用性,在Linux 子系統上已經大多能體現了,所以根本沒有什麼必要;而且專利方面,蘋果雖然開源了XNU核心原始碼,但是 原始碼遵循蘋果的 Apple Public Source License 2.0 ,這是一個非常嚴格的開源認證了,如果直接用於 像Windows 這樣的大型商用系統,是必須要Apple 授權的,微軟肯定不會願意去支付這一筆費用;
對於蘋果公司來說,蘋果旗下的 軟硬體產品 都結合的非常緊密,逐步形成它獨有的 軟硬體生態,軟體和硬體 兩者 都缺一不可,所以蘋果基本上是不可能會將自己的軟體作業系統 給到其他
公司,因為它根本想這樣做,如果做了,反而還會因小失大。
總結微軟從技術上 現在是可以 相容Mac OS 使用的核心XNU 的,但是 微軟絕對不會去這樣做,因為 無論從增加Windows實用性上 還是 商業上,都是得不償失的,我們也就看不到 相容Mac OS 的那一天了。
-
6 # 幹年的王八萬年的龜
正版macos就是蘋果mac高價格低配置最大的底氣,也是mac好用的秘訣,蘋果不可能把macos拱手讓給別人
-
7 # 地攤的飯
無希望,windows上執行其他的Linux本質上還是虛擬機器。且不說技術上如何完美相容,就是蘋果也不會同意合併的
微軟公司已經推出了可以安裝在Win10的Linux子系統。Linux是一個類UNIX系統。蘋果公司的Mac os也是一個類UNIX系統。Win10能夠相容Linux,是否意味著Win10可以相容Mac os?你認為微軟未來有可能會跟蘋果合作推出基於Win10的Mac os子系統麼?
回覆列表
Linux是開源的所以封裝在自己的產品包中沒問題,蘋果的軟體是閉源的法律就不能這麼做。其實微軟跟蘋果的合作歷史很悠久,不需要這麼做。